which sentence explains what it means for a claim to be debatable? (1 point)
it is something people could have differing opinions about.
it is based on facts that cannot be refuted.
it can be supported with evidence.
it can be proven true or false.
A debatable claim allows for multiple viewpoints. Facts that can't be refuted are not debatable. Just being supportable by evidence or provable true/false isn't the essence of being debatable; it's the existence of different possible opinions.
